Features

The Browning Defender Pro Scout Max Wireless Trail Camera comes with numerous features that make it stand out from other trail cameras. Here are some of the key features:

  • 20MP Camera
  • Wireless Capabilities
  • 80ft Detection Range
  • Adjustable Trigger Speed and Detection Range
  • Full HD Videos with Sound
  • Lightning-Fast Recovery Time
  • No-Glow Infrared Flash
  • 2" Color Viewing Screen
  • Time-Lapse Plus Shooting Mode
  • Smart IR Video
  • SD Card Management

The camera uses a 20MP lens, which produces sharp and clear images with minimal noise. The wireless capabilities allow you to view and download images and videos from the camera on your smartphone or tablet. This makes it easy to monitor wildlife activity, without having to physically visit the camera site. The 80ft detection range ensures that the camera captures images of animals, even from a distance. Additionally, the adjustable trigger speed and detection range allow you to customize the camera to your specific needs.

The camera records Full HD videos with sound, allowing you to capture the sounds of animals in addition to their movements. The lightning-fast recovery time ensures that the camera is ready to capture another image or video within 0.6 seconds after the first one. The no-glow infrared flash ensures that animals will not be spooked by camera flashes, resulting in more natural images. The 2" color viewing screen allows you to preview images and videos directly from the camera.

The time-lapse plus shooting mode allows you to capture images and videos at set intervals, which is great for capturing slow-moving animals, such as bears or deer. The smart IR video mode automatically adjusts the brightness of the infrared flash, resulting in optimal video quality. Lastly, the SD card management feature allows you to manage your SD cards, ensuring you never run out of storage space.

Cons

Despite its numerous advantages, the Browning Defender Pro Scout Max Wireless Trail Camera is not without its cons. Here are some of its cons:

  • Expensive
  • Large and Heavy
  • Requires Subscription for Wireless Capabilities
  • Difficult to Set Up

The camera is relatively expensive, making it less accessible for some hunters and nature enthusiasts. Additionally, the camera is large and heavy, making it difficult to move around. The wireless capabilities require a subscription, which may not be feasible for some users. Lastly, the camera can be difficult to set up, especially for beginners.
